Where It Shines: Real Projects, Real Stitching

I tested Nurse Hero Valentine Typography Tee across three real-world items: a medium-weight cotton tote bag (for a local clinic fundraiser), a 100% cotton baby onesie (as a keepsake gift), and a brushed poly-cotton apron (for a boutique café run by an RN). On the tote, it stitched cleanly at 4.2" wide—no thread breaks, no puckering—thanks to its moderate stitch density and generous letter spacing. The satin-stitched outlines held crisp edges even over the fabric’s slight texture. On the onesie, I resized it to 3.1" and used lightweight cutaway + tear-away stabilizer: the fill stitches remained smooth, and the smaller caps (like the “N” and “H”) retained their shape—no bleeding or distortion. The apron was the real test: curved seam near the pocket, slightly stretchy base fabric. With proper hooping and a light spray adhesive, the design stayed true, and customers remarked how “clear and respectful” it looked—not decorative, but meaningful.

Practical Notes Every Embroiderer Should Check

Before stitching Nurse Hero Valentine Typography Tee on your next project: test it on scrap fabric matching your final substrate; verify thread color contrast against both light and dark backgrounds; review stitch density—if it feels overly dense for your fabric, consider simplifying fill areas in editing software; confirm your hoop size accommodates the full width comfortably (aim for at least 0.5" margin); inspect tiny details like serifs or crossbars at actual stitch-out size; and always use appropriate stabilizer—lightweight cutaway for knits, tear-away for stable wovens. If selling finished products commercially, double-check licensing terms—some Graphics files allow unlimited physical use but restrict resale of the digital embroidery file itself.
